Is gravity alone sufficient to explain the behavior of the tinsel in the Levitating-orb system? Explain why.

Answer: The orb is attracted to the pipe at first because the orb has a positive charge. As soon as the orb touches the pipe, it picks up a negative charge. Since the pipe is negative and the tinsel orb is now negative, they repel away from each other and the orb levitates!
